- Claim Lifecycle Management: Prepare, review, and submit clean claims daily through Open Dental to ensure rapid reimbursement.
- Insurance Verification & Breakdown: Obtain detailed, accurate insurance breakdowns and input them cleanly into patient files.
- Payer Liaison & Appeals: Proactively follow up on outstanding, unpaid, denied, or rejected claims, advocating on behalf of our practices.
- Financial Accuracy: Audit aging reports, process co-pays, and post insurance payments with sharp, reliable attention to detail.
- State Residency: Must currently live and be eligible to work in Nevada, California, Oregon, Idaho, or Washington (required).
- Software Mastery: 1 to 3 years of hands-on experience navigating Open Dental claims administration (required).
- Clearinghouse Tech: Familiarity with DentalXchange, Trex (Vyne), or other major billing clearinghouses is highly preferred.
- Payer Communication Skills: Exceptional telephone communication skills and strong persistence when navigating insurance IVR systems and claims adjusters.
- Schedule Alignment: Fully comfortable working consistent Pacific Time Zone hours.
- Safety & Compliance: Successful completion of a routine pre-employment drug screening is required.
